This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Illinois.
• Conduct phone consultations with patients participating in care management and/or remote patient monitoring programs, offering support and education regarding their chronic conditions.
• Inform patients about their health issues and empower them with lifestyle and behavioral strategies to effectively manage their chronic conditions.
• Aid patients in establishing and achieving objectives aligned with their provider-approved care plans.
• Keep precise and updated patient records, ensuring that all interactions and care plans are documented according to protocol.
• Address patient concerns and obstacles to care, striving to discover practical solutions that enhance patient adherence and outcomes.
• Deliver clear, compassionate, and effective communication to patients.
• Adhere to approved workflows when conveying patient needs to their healthcare providers.
• Engage in training sessions, team meetings, and quality improvement initiatives to refine the care navigation process and enhance the patient experience.
• Respond to remotely transmitted patient data, such as blood pressure, blood glucose, weight, and pulse oximetry, in accordance with established partner workflows.
• A current, valid, and in good standing Multistate/Compact Nursing License (LPN/LVN).
• Additional state licenses may be necessary and will be reimbursed by HealthSnap.
• Over 3 years of experience in primary care practice, cardiology, internal medicine, home care, or chronic care management/remote patient monitoring.
•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
• Excellent organizational and time management skills.
• Proficient in using electronic health records (EHR) and care management software.
• Capability to work independently as well as collaboratively within a team.
• Empathy and a patient-centered approach to care.
• Reliable internet connection and a HIPAA-compliant work environment, with proficiency in virtual communication tools (e.g., Zoom, Slack).
